Output 5ad61ba655fad5de493a09d49bb9124eeaacc399e398191cb3f27d8040dd2118:1

value
39845760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e0b5763c185e858720fc41ba2211753f48a2255 OP_EQUAL
address
3Ee5To6d4L7dGphzkDKz5nCdCkeR6SRduD
transaction
5ad61ba655fad5de493a09d49bb9124eeaacc399e398191cb3f27d8040dd2118
spent
true